Perfect for deadheading flowers to keep them blooming
I don't think I would use this to trim and edge grass; I much prefer a power trimmer to do that but I bought this to add reach so I can cut ripe flower heads that are trying to set seeds. My beds are 12 feet wide but are accessible front and rear; I now can reach in and trim the flowers in the middle of the bed. This has greatly extended my flowering season. I shop & receive so many items from Amazon that I no longer write reviews but this "grass edger" is the ideal tool for deadheading annuals and perennials. It is a "must have" tool for the serious gardener.

Review & Comparison of all 3 Fiskars Grass Shears
I purchased all 3 of Fiskars grass shears (36" Long-Handled, Power-Lever, and Swivel Blade). After using them all, here's the details after actually using them. The long-handled is a great idea and makes trimming easier. Rotating blade stays in place when used. The tips of the first one I bought wouldn't cut so I returned it for a replacement. The replacement worked better, but the blades don't stay sharp for long. The blades for both the long-handle and the swivel blade shears are thinner and don't hold up. I GIVE THE LONG-HANDLED SHEARS A RATING OF 3.5.The swivel blade grass shears had a lot of issues. As just mentioned, the blades are thin & dull quickly. The blades also would occasionally rotate while trimming instead of staying in place (this was not an issue with the long-handled version). The switch to lock the swivel blade shears is on the side rather than on the top like their other models. This switch would slide down into the locking position about every 10 clips and was a nuisance with having to keep unlocking it. I GIVE THE SWIVEL BLADE SHEARS A RATING OF 2.The power-level shears performed very well. The blades are thicker/stronger than the other models and stay sharp longer. I had no issues with these. Well made! Excellent shears! I GIVE THE POWER-LEVER SHEARS A RATING OF 5.
